If the IRS has already corrected your return there is no need to also amend it ... but if you want to make the corrections for your records then use the amendment process just don't mail it in unless you need the IRS to reconsider something.  

 

Be careful ... the amendment process must start with the return AS CORRECTED by the IRS ... column A must reflect those amounts if you are going to file the 1040X.
